tpr a collagen material? The answer is yes. There are many ways to wrap the glue with TPR\TPE, and the glue-encapsulation process is very mature. As a glue-encapsulation material, TPR mainly improves the feel and comfort of plastic products, anti-slip, aesthetics, and anti-collision effects. Lien TPE manufacturer will talk about several ways of coating for your reference.

The most common coating method: secondary injection molding. TPE is bonded to plastic by injection molding. This bonding is mainly due to the hot melt adhesiveness of the TPE itself, and does not melt the two materials at the coating interface. TPE and metal coating are also adhesive. However, metal and TPE cannot be directly adhered, so the metal surface needs to be coated first, and then a layer of TPE soft material is outsourced. The coating layer on the metal surface acts as a dielectric, thereby achieving TPE and metal coating.

TPE Another way of coating: fusion. It refers to the melting bond between TPE and the coated part at the coating interface at the high temperature. It usually occurs between TPE with close polarity and compatibility and plastic parts. During injection molding and coating, TPE and plastic are at the coating interface. At the microscopic, the two materials are intertwined at the molecular chain level. At the macroscopic level, the material penetrates through melting at the interface, thereby producing excellent binding force at the coating interface.

TPE material adhesive wrapping method: embed. Sometimes the TPE and plastic or other materials are not covered with firmness, so you can make holes at the appropriate position of the covering part, and make rough, concave and concave surfaces, concave and concave grooves, etc. This increases the bonding firmness between the TPE material and the coated part.

TPE material coating method: wrap. TPE completely covers the entire surface of the plastic part (made). Since it is a whole package, there is no problem of not being able to cover it. However, for some parts with irregular surfaces and edges, it is recommended to use TPE with higher hardness to make the combination of TPE and the parts more stable. Is
